Rate limits on the Gatefold internal API gateway: 120 requests/minute per plugin, burst of 20. Exceed it and you get a 429 with a retry-after header — honor it. Limits reset on the minute boundary. No exemptions for batch jobs; paginate instead. To register your plugin and publish builds, sign each bundle with the key below.

rollout seal: bky4_x7Gc

Handover: Tollgate payment retries

Welcome aboard! Short version: Tollgate now attaches an idempotency key to every payment retry so duplicate charges can't slip through. Keys live in Redis with a 24h TTL. Don't touch the retry backoff without pinging me first. The service reads the following settings at startup.

settings of yajof-bagaf:
ZORWYN_LOG_LEVEL=warn
ZORWYN_METRICS_HOST=metrics.zorwyn.nelvroworks.corp
ZORWYN_POOL_SIZE=4

Subject: Quiet room — top floor

Team assistants,

The quiet room on level 9 (west end, past the plant wall) is now bookable in half-hour slots. No calls, no meetings over two people, no food. Cleaners come at 07:00, so last slot ends 18:30. Report broken blinds or lights to facilities, not to us.

The door stays locked outside booked slots. To unlock it for a confirmed booking, key in the code below.

door code, tagef-bajop: bdg-SB-7

- [ ] **Step 7: Breaker override escrow.** After sealing the signing keys for the Tallgrove upstream API circuit breaker, confirm the support team can force the breaker open during a full outage. The override bundle lives in the sealed escrow drawer and is useless without its unlock phrase. Two ceremony witnesses must initial this step before proceeding. The escrow bundle is decrypted with the recovery passphrase that follows.

vault phrase of kahip-kahop = holath-quenmir